How to populate Voicent Dashboard with an Agent Script

I am using agent dialer the predictive dialer and can not figure out how to get a script to my agents. What is the easiest way to get a script to our agents?

Great question! Luckily, Voicent offers multiple ways to get a script to your agents.

Voicent Script Requirement:
The only requirement for a third party script is that it is web based. PHP, JSP, ASP.Net, HTML, HTM, and almost all other web based programming languages are supported for a third party Voicent script. IVR Studio is provided for users who want to build scripts on the fly.

Voicent Script is deploy-able in:

  • AgentDialer – GUI
  • AgentDialer – API
  • BroadcastByPhone – GUI
  • BroadcastByPhone – API
  • Voicent Gateway – GUI

AgentDialer – GUI Script Deployment
Simply open “AgentDialer” and under the “Predictive” tab you will have “Select Script URL…”. This will open the “Select Campaign Script” window, letting you input a third party URL or you can select a IVR deployed script.

BroadcastByPhone – GUI Script Deployment
Simply open “BroadcastByPhone” and under the “Broadcast” tab you will have “Select Script URL…”. This will open the “Select Campaign Script” window, letting you input a third party URL or you can select a IVR deployed script.

Voicent Gateway – Global Script Deployment
By specifying a script on the Voicent Gateway, you will be able to have a global script. This global script can be for any outbound phone call, as well as any campaign. This is useful if you only need one universal script.
